Merge remote-tracking branch 'origin/master' into staging
[mirror/dsa-puppet.git] / modules / roles / templates / anonscm / anonscm.debian.org.conf.erb
diff --git a/modules/roles/templates/anonscm/anonscm.debian.org.conf.erb b/modules/roles/templates/anonscm/anonscm.debian.org.conf.erb
new file mode 100644 (file)
index 0000000..ca667dc
--- /dev/null
@@ -0,0 +1,37 @@
+##
+## THIS FILE IS UNDER PUPPET CONTROL. DON'T EDIT IT HERE.
+## USE: git clone git+ssh://$USER@puppet.debian.org/srv/puppet.debian.org/git/dsa-puppet.git
+##
+
+<Macro vhost-inner-anonscm.debian.org>
+       ServerName anonscm.debian.org
+       ServerAlias git.debian.org
+       ServerAdmin debian-admin@lists.debian.org
+
+       ErrorLog /var/log/apache2/anonscm.debian.org-error.log
+       CustomLog /var/log/apache2/anonscm.debian.org-access.log privacy
+
+       DocumentRoot /srv/anonscm.debian.org/htdocs
+       <Directory /srv/anonscm.debian.org/htdocs>
+               Require all granted
+               AllowOverride None
+       </Directory>
+
+       RewriteEngine on
+       Use anonscm.debian.org-anonscm-map
+</Macro>
+
+<VirtualHost *:443>
+       Use vhost-inner-anonscm.debian.org
+
+       Use common-debian-service-ssl anonscm.debian.org
+       Use common-ssl-HSTS
+       Use http-pkp-anonscm.debian.org
+</VirtualHost>
+
+<VirtualHost *:80>
+       Use vhost-inner-anonscm.debian.org
+</VirtualHost>
+
+# vim:set syn=apache:
+# vim:set syn=apache: